Jump to content
djsa79

Relacionar 3 Caixa de Combinação

Recommended Posts

djsa79

Boa noite. Gostaria que me ajudassem.

Tenho uma tabela Calibres: com [Ref_Calibre],[Tipo_Calibre],[Medida_Calibre] e [Ref_Peça]

Tenho outra tabela Calibres_Dados: com [Ref_Calibre],[Tipo_Calibre],[Medida_Calibre],[Ref_Peça],[Operario],[Departamento],[data_saída],[data_entrada],[dias_uso]

Fiz um formulários com os dados da tabela Calibres_Dados. Agora gostaria que ao selecionar Ref_Calibre automaticamente aparecesse os dados relacionados da tabela Calibres neste caso ],[Tipo_Calibre],[Medida_Calibre] e [Ref_Peça].

Podiam me ajudar?

Share this post


Link to post
Share on other sites
Colector Boy

Para isso basta interligares as duas tabelas.

Como é que fazes isso?

simples...

ve qual e o elemento comum nas duas tabelas e que julgo eu e chave nas duas

e depois fazes uma expressao SQL (select) que relaciona as duas tabelas utilizando esse elemento e garanindo que esse elemento e igual ao valor introduzido pelo utilizador

e dizendo quais os elementos que queres mostrar da tabela Calibres

Espero ter ajudado.

Tentei nao te dar a solucao mas ajudar-te a alcanca-la.

Edited by Colector Boy

Share this post


Link to post
Share on other sites
carlosAl

Penso que se defenires a origem dos registos do formulario calibres_dados:

SELECT calibres_dados.ref_calibre, calibres_dados.operario, calibres_dados.departamento, calibres_dados.datasaida, calibres_dados.dataentrada, calibres_dados.diasuso, tblcalibres.tipo_calibre, tblcalibres.medida_calibre, tblcalibres.ref_pca
FROM calibres_dados INNER JOIN tblcalibres ON calibres_dados.ref_calibre = tblcalibres.ref_calibre;

quando adicionares novos registros, e inserires uma ref_calibre os outros campos (tipo_calibre e medida_calibre), ja vem preenchidos no form com origem na tabela calibres

Edited by Rui Carlos
GeSHi

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

×
×
  • Create New...

Important Information

By using this site you accept our Terms of Use and Privacy Policy. We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.